Value Proposition and Pricing

Competitive Pricing Strategies

Xiaomi’s core philosophy revolves around offering flagship-level specifications at aggressive price points. They achieve this by selling online directly to consumers and minimizing marketing spend on traditional channels. This “bare-bones” approach allows them to pass the savings directly to the customer. For the budget-conscious buyer, a review Xiaomi phone almost always concludes with praise for the value proposition.

You are getting top-tier processors, high amounts of RAM, and fast storage for a fraction of the cost of brands like Apple or Samsung. This value is simply unmatched in the current market landscape. It democratizes access to powerful technology, making it available to a wider audience. The price-to-performance ratio is the king of the hill.

Global Warranty and Service Network

In the past, one of the drawbacks of buying Xiaomi outside of China was the lack of official warranty and service centers. However, the company has been rapidly expanding its global footprint to address this concern. Now, many regions offer official warranties and authorized service centers, which is a huge relief for international buyers. This improved support structure makes a review Xiaomi phone much more appealing to new customers.

Knowing that you can get your device repaired officially adds a layer of security to the investment. While the network is still growing, it is a positive sign of the brand’s commitment to customer satisfaction. This move legitimizes the brand as a serious player in the global market.
